They may have got through on the old scheme but not anymore. My car has them straight from japan, they came standard on all turbo models. I have asked my compliance agent to keep them but he wont have a bar of it. RAW's workshops have to much to risk these days so they are not willing to bend the rules. They have to disconnect or cut the high voltage leads from the power packs and modify the standard xenon light housing to fit the new halogen globes. I will be able to refit xenon globes but just have to reconnect the old packs and find some globes!

Xenons would have been removed during compliance (self leveling and cleaning issue) So you have 4 door R34 headlights most prob, or R34 GT headlights. There were factory standard Xenons, so prob best to hunt around or some original factory R34 Xenons.

Just check whether the bulbs are the only thing different, does your headlight assembly have 'Xenon' written anywhere? Some places just changed the wiring/powerpacks for the globes. but i think most places replaced the entire assembly unfortunately.
